Job Description
The Precertification Specialist Team Lead reports to the Central Precert Unit Supervisor and oversees daily operations of the preauthorization team to ensure timely, accurate, and compliant authorization of medical services. This role provides leadership, coaching, and workflow coordination while serving as a subject matter expert for payer requirements, medical necessity guidelines, and authorization processes. The Team Lead acts as a liaison between staff, providers, and payers to support optimal patient access and revenue integrity.
Responsibilities:
1. Team Leadership & Staff Development – 30%
Lead, mentor, and support preauthorization staff to meet productivity, quality, and turnaround time standards
Assign and prioritize workloads based on service urgency and payer requirement
Serve as escalation point for complex, urgent, or denied authorization cases
Assist with onboarding, training, and ongoing staff education
Provide coaching, feedback, and performance input to management
2. Preauthorization Processing & Oversight – 30%
Review, process, and oversee complex or high-risk authorization requests
Ensure compliance with payer policies, medical necessity criteria, and internal workflows
Collaborate with clinical teams to obtain accurate and complete documentation
Monitor authorization status to prevent delays in patient care or scheduled services
Maintain accurate documentation in EHR and practice management systems
3. Quality Assurance & Performance Monitoring – 20%
Monitor key performance indicators (KPIs) including turnaround time, approval rates, and denial trends
Conduct quality audits and provide corrective guidance to staff
Identify root causes of denials and process gaps
Support denial prevention strategies and appeals when needed
Recommend and assist with process improvement initiatives
4. Communication & Cross-Functional Collaboration – 15%
Serve as primary point of contact for providers, payers, and internal departments regarding authorization issuesCommunicate payer updates, policy changes, and workflow expectations to staff
Participate in meetings related to patient access, utilization management, and revenue cycle performance
Escalate risks or delays to leadership in a timely manner
5. Reporting & Administrative Support – 5%
Assist with preparation of reports related to productivity, quality, and authorization outcomes
Support policy, procedure, and workflow documentation updates
Perform other duties as assigned to support departmental goals
